Home Infusion IV Pharmacy Technician 3 Job at Oregon Health & Science University

Oregon Health & Science University Beaverton, OR

Department Overview:
This position provides technical support to pharmacists through preparation of intravenous admixtures, unit doses, inventory management, and preparation of Home Infusion deliveries. Home infusion technicians working this shift are responsible for ensuring accountability and accuracy of standard operations procedures in home infusion pharmacy. Position works under direct supervision of a Pharmacist who is responsible for the safe and proper distribution of medication to home infusion patients.
Function/Duties of Position:
Prepare, mix and compound sterile medications, including chemotherapy, following aseptic procedure guidelines.
Maintain cleanliness and sterility of USP ISO 5, 7, and 8 areas through daily, weekly, and monthly cleaning.
Prepare and package medication and supplies for patient deliveries.
Organize and restock work areas during and prior to end of shift, and remove expired medication.
Coordinate patient care by answering telephone, filing, medication profile update and maintenance.
Perform other technician duties as assigned.
Required Qualifications:
Education
  • Completion of high school degree
Registrations, Certifications & Licenses
  • Licensed by the State of Oregon Board of Pharmacy
  • Certification from the National Pharmacy Technician Certification Board or National Healthcareer Association.
    • Certification must be maintained.
Experience
  • 2 years of pharmacy work experience, or equivalent additional education
  • Computer keyboard
Job Related Knowledge, Skills & Competencies
  • Ability to read and understand medical- related terms
  • Ability to perform basic pharmaceutical mathematics calculations
  • Skill at manipulating small objects, e.g., needles, syringes, ampules
  • Ability to use mechanical system for transfer of fluids
  • Knowledge of and skill at application of aseptic technique
  • Ability to establish priorities in workflow
  • Good interpersonal communication skills
  • Ability to work under supervision of diverse Pharmacists
  • Must be able to perform the essential functions of this position with or without accommodation.
Preferred Qualifications:
Education
  • Formal pharmacy technician training program
Experience
  • Inpatient and outpatient hospital pharmacy experience
Job Related Knowledge, Skills & Competencies
  • Medical and scientific nomenclature
Additional Details:
Environment, Physical Demands & Equipment Usage

Possible exposure to hazardous chemicals and noise. Flexibility in scheduling of shift times. Accountability for accuracy associated with performance of the duties to this position.

Ability to stand/walk, push or pull delivery carts, bending and reaching for 6-8 continuous hours per day. Maintain medication movement and stock to accommodate patient needs. Ability to manipulate dosage form devices (i.e., syringes, unit dose packaging etc).
